At its core, BaaS is a cloud-based platform that provides pre-built backend services, such as data storage, authentication, and APIs. These services are designed to be scalable, secure, and reliable, and can be easily integrated with frontend applications. The BaaS provider manages the backend infrastructure, including servers, databases, and security, freeing up developers to focus on the frontend and user experience.
This approach has a number of advantages, including reduced costs, increased efficiency, and improved scalability. With BaaS, companies can avoid the upfront costs of building and maintaining their own backend infrastructure, and instead pay only for the services they use. Defining BaaS
BaaS is a cloud-based model that provides pre-built backend services and infrastructure for building and deploying applications. This approach allows developers to focus on the frontend and user experience, while the backend is managed by the cloud provider. BaaS is often compared to other cloud-based models, such as Platform as a Service (PaaS) and Infrastructure as a Service (IaaS). While all three models provide cloud-based services, they differ in terms of the level of control and management provided to the user.
The following table compares the key features of BaaS, PaaS, and IaaS:
| Model | Description | Level of Control |
|---|---|---|
| BaaS | Pre-built backend services and infrastructure | Low |
| PaaS | Pre-built platform for developing and deploying applications | Medium |
| IaaS | Virtualized computing resources, such as servers and storage | High |
As shown in the table, BaaS provides pre-built backend services and infrastructure, with a low level of control provided to the user. This is in contrast to PaaS and IaaS, which provide more control and flexibility, but also require more management and maintenance. BaaS is often used for building mobile and web applications, where the focus is on providing a great user experience and fast time-to-market.
